Facilities Attendant - Spokane Club

Full-Time Position at Spokane's Premier Private Club

The Spokane Club is seeking a dedicated Facilities Attendant to maintain the highest standards of cleanliness and functionality across our hotel and athletic facilities. This full-time position is essential to ensuring our members and guests enjoy pristine facilities that reflect our commitment to excellence.

Shift available: 8:30 pm- 5 am

Night position will receive night shift differential for pay.

What You'll Do
  • Locker Room Maintenance : Maintain exceptional cleanliness standards, stock amenities, and ensure all equipment functions properly
  • Hotel & Athletic Facilities : Clean hotel rooms, banquet spaces, conditioning rooms, and common areas
  • Daily Operations : Vacuum, mop, dust, handle trash removal, wash windows, and shampoo carpets
  • Inventory Management : Monitor and stock cleaning supplies and locker room amenities
  • Linen Service : Collect soiled linens and distribute clean linens throughout facilities
  • Member Service : Resolve member concerns using effective customer service skills
  • Special Projects : Assist with events, programs, and facility improvements as needed
  • Equipment Care : Clean and maintain conditioning room equipment and cleaning tools
What We're Looking For

Required:

  • Minimum age 18 with high school diploma or equivalent
  • Previous janitorial, maintenance, or housekeeping experience preferred
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s regularly and up to 80 lbs occasionally
  • Manual dexterity to operate cleaning equipment (floor scrubbers, carpet extractors, etc.)
  • Ability to climb ladders and remain on feet for most of shift
  • Understanding of proper cleaning materials and equipment usage
  • Ability to pass criminal background check

Ideal Candidate:

  • Self-starting personality with positive, professional attitude
  • Strong organizational skills and ability to manage daily workflow
  • Team player willing to assist coworkers and adapt to changing needs
  • Takes pride and ownership in work quality
  • Excellent customer service skills for member interactions
Benefits Package

Health & Financial Benefits

  • Medical, Dental, Vision, and Basic Life Insurance available for full-time employees
  • 401(k) plan enrollment after one year of service
  • Up to 10 vacation days per year based on hours worked
  • 6 paid holidays throughout the calendar year
